
Computing | Khan Academy
Learn AP Computer Science Principles using videos, articles, and AP-aligned multiple choice question practice. Review the fundamentals of digital data representation, computer components, internet …
Khan Academy | Free Online Courses, Lessons & Practice
Learn for free about math, art, computer programming, economics, physics, chemistry, biology, medicine, finance, history, and more. Khan Academy is a nonprofit with the mission of providing a …
Hour of Code on Khan Academy | Khan Academy
The Hour of Code is a global movement by Computer Science Education Week and Code.org reaching tens of millions of students in 180+ countries through a one-hour introduction to computer science …
Computer programming - JavaScript and the web - Khan Academy
Computer programming - JavaScript and the web Unit 1: Intro to JS: Drawing & Animation Intro to programming Drawing basics Coloring Variables Animation basics Interactive programs Becoming a …
Computers and the Internet | Computing | Khan Academy
Unit 2: Computers Unit mastery: 0% Introducing computers From electricity to bits Logic gates and circuits Computer components Computer files
Browse Projects | Khan Academy
Take a look at some amazing computer programming projects created by Khan users from around the world! See a program that inspires you? Be sure to vote it up, ask a question or make your very own …
Computer science theory | Computing | Khan Academy
Explore advanced computer science topics from algorithms (how we solve common computing problems and measure our solutions' efficiency), to cryptography (how we protect secret information), to …
AP®︎ Computer Science Principles (AP®︎ CSP) | Khan Academy
Learn AP Computer Science Principles using videos, articles, and AP-aligned multiple choice question practice. Review the fundamentals of digital data representation, computer components, internet …
Computer Science | Computing | Khan Academy
Computing Computer Science Course summary Getting Connected: Internet KA ICT Class 10 KA Computer Science Class 11 KA Informatics Practices Class 11 KA Computer Science Class 12 KA …
Intro to computer science - Python | Computing | Khan Academy
Unit 7: Building software with classes Attributes Methods Class design Composition Programming robots Reference docs